TRANSITIONAL CARE

Elderly care and support

When it's not time to go home, but you're well enough to leave acute care.

Garfield County Hospital District offers transitional care services for patients that are ready to leave traditional acute care in the hospital but are not yet ready to return home or to their previous living situation. These patients still require additional skilled medical care, nursing care or rehabilitation services.
 
Garfield County Hospital District’s transitional care team is trained and equipped to provide care for patients with non-acute, but still complex needs, including:

 

  • Post-surgical care, including cardiac, neuro, orthopedic and abdominal

  • Respiratory care

  • Wound care for wound healing and prevention

  • Intravenous (IV) antibiotics and therapy to treat a variety of infections and conditions

 
Additionally, our transition care team works in collaboration with other services at Garfield County Hospital District to provide rehabilitation care during a transitional care stay, such as:

 

  • Physical therapy

  • Occupational therapy

  • Speech therapy

  • Rehabilitative therapy supportive services
